Super Dungeon Maker is a creative pixel art dungeon editor inspired by the best 2D adventure games. Choose however many levels, enemies, secret rooms, traps and items you want. Challenge your friends and the community to master your dungeon or play the countless dungeons of the community.

Not polished or tested well at all. First weird jank I noticed almost immediately was that attacking was extremely inconsistent. Turns out that's because the sword always attacks towards your mouse. Fair enough. Except the shield only defends towards where your movement keys were facing, and ignores the mouse entirely. Neato. Two totally separate aiming methods for literally no reason at all. Great start. Pushable blocks can be set to only be pushed from one direction, except with no visual distinction between those and the ones that can be pushed in any direction. Which way can this block be pushed? Who knows! You also have to hold the use key in order to push things, for some inexplicable reason. Then, when I tried a player-made dungeon, I almost immediately got soft-locked because a particular terrain object reappeared while I was standing in that spot. This doesn't look like it was intended by the dungeon maker, so the only conclusion I can come to is that the game wasn't actually tested. Joy. Another half-finished game. https://steamcommunity.com/sharedfiles/filedetails/?id=3428846249 While it's nice that there's some folks trying to make Mario/Zelda-Maker style games, it would really be nice if they were actually well made instead of being janky and un-tested.

Some of the player made dungeons are HARD, but just like Mario Maker, there is various levels depending. The game itself has several dungeons you can play for fun as well, but the main thing here is the Dungeon Maker itself. Though I honestly do think there could (and should) be more options available, especially in my opinion with enemies and maybe more items like a bow would be really awesome. That said, what IS there is great, and this game can honestly take up all your time if you allow it too

Fun little game for level editor lovers such as myself. Think Super Mario Maker except for the dungeon crawler genre. Although, if you're more of a player than a maker, I don't believe it's worth it- but, if you're into building, give it a go!
